FROM THE GREEK.

THE rose no garland needs, nor you, my Queen, Sparkle of jewelled crown or silken sheen. More fair than pearls yon are, beyond compare ... , . Of gold the glory of your shining hair; Far India's sapphire, bright as starry SKiea, Pales ineffectual by those radiant eyes. .
